The school bell rang indicating the end of the lessons for that day. After greeting the teachers, the students went out of their classes and headed to the places they wanted to go. Some still wanted to stay in school while some chose to go home. Among the students who preferred to go home, ByulHee was one of them. She walked out of her class and strode straight to the school gate, expecting her daddy to pick her up as usual.

But much to her dismay, her daddy was nowhere in sight hence she frowned a little as she looked around the place. ByulHee couldn’t help but to feel weird with her daddy’s absence. For years, Chen was never late to pick her up from school and he was always on time.

ByulHee knew that she was going to her daddy’s library that day but Chen will still be the one who took her there each time she told him that she wanted to visit her daddy’s workplace.

ByulHee went to the nearest public phone and started to call Chen. In her heart she began to feel a little uneasy as it was very unlikely for Chen not to pick her up from school. Even during the most rarest conditions when Chen suddenly had an urgent thing to do, he will still somehow tell her to wait for him until he came.

But that day, no word from Chen. Nothing. And worry gnawed at her. ByulHee was starting to feel that panic was rising in her as she was scared if anything had happened to her daddy. She waited a moment for her dad to pick up the phone and she sighed in relief when she heard Chen’s voice on the other line.

“Daddy !” Called the 12 year old. “Where are you ? Are you alright ? Why aren’t you picking me up today ?” ByulHee shot Chen with questions that lingered on her mind. She felt like a heavy load was lifted from her shoulders once Chen told her that he was fine and he was already at home, waiting for her.

ByulHee frowned deeper at her daddy’s answer. Chen was already at home ? “You’re at home already ? I thought I told you I’ll visit your workplace.” ByulHee said as she tried not to sound angry at her daddy’s drastic actions. Chen had never done this before. If anything he will definitely tell her first as to not have her worry. But unfortunately, something seemed to be wrong with her father that day.

First, he didn’t pick her up and second, he was already at home when his work time hadn’t even ended yet.

“I’m sorry, hon, but I’ll take you there some other time okay ? I need you to be home now. I can’t pick you up today so I need you to walk home. Walk straight home, okay ?” Chen said gently and in his mind he knew that confusion had been all over his daughter’s mind. He was sure that once his princess got home, he will be interrogated with questions from little miss detective.

ByulHee sighed a little before she just obeyed to her father’s instructions as she ended the call. She stepped away from the public phone and began to walk home. “I’m sure daddy has a good explanation for this. He won’t usually go home without me. He says it’s dangerous for me to walk home alone. But he didn’t care about it today so something must have gone wrong.” ByulHee made her own assumptions as she crossed the road and walked on the familiar pavements towards her house.

She couldn’t help but to feel the annoying silence on her journey back home. Everyday once she had finished her school, Chen will pick her up and together they will walk home with either Chen or her telling each other stories and laughters will be heard as they walked side by side with Chen holding her hand.

But that day, she felt a sudden longing of the memories and even though those just happened recently, she felt as if it had taken place a long time ago. And a part of her told her that those were the last times Chen will walk her home.

ByulHee shook the thoughts off as she finally reached the front door of her small and cozy house. She took off her shoes and her eyes widened once she saw another two pairs of shoes, each belonged to a man and a woman beside her daddy’s. She knew her daddy’s shoes very well but ByulHee couldn’t recall the other two. They looked very expensive and high class and nothing that her father can afford.

More questions started to form inside her brain and she couldn’t wait to know the answers. She opened the door with her keys that Chen had given to her as a spare and opened the door. She stepped inside the house and was shocked to see her daddy sitting in front of a couple that looked not much difference from her daddy’s age. Maybe a year or two older from her dad.

Three pairs of eyes turned to her and ByulHee was still frozen at the front door. She wasn’t sure if she should enter the house or just go back out since she could feel tense in the atmosphere and it seemed like the three elders were having a serious conversation. Hence explaining the tense in the air.

“ByulHee.” Chen called as he gave her a small smile. ByulHee turned to her dad before slowly walking towards the three of them in the living room. Maybe after giving the strangers a greeting, she can lock herself up in the room until they left.

ByulHee glanced a little at the strangers and admitted that she had never seen them before and she knew they weren’t from here. By the looks of what they were wearing, ByulHee understood immediately that they were from the city.

ByulHee sat beside her daddy as Chen had insisted her to. She felt someone was staring straight at her and went she looked to see who it was, she met eyes with the woman who was looking at her with loving eyes.

ByulHee couldn’t tear her eyes from the woman as she felt a strange feeling inside of her. She knew that she had never met this woman before and also the person beside her who ByulHee assumed as her husband, judging by how close they sat with each other and the way they held each other’s hands. This was the first time they met but ByulHee felt a strong attachment towards the both of them.

It was something she felt towards her daddy and she couldn’t fathom why she somehow felt the same way towards the couple.

“She’s grown.” The man said as he, too, looked at ByulHee as if she was a piece of diamond. ByulHee looked up at her daddy and found him smiling down at her. Somehow, the look in her daddy’s eyes were trying to tell her something but she couldn’t decipher the meaning. Chen’s smile was also unlike the usual smile he gave her. This time his smile was sad and seemed like it was forced. ByulHee didn’t know why but she felt like her daddy was going to cry anytime soon.

ByulHee had a lot of questions in her mind but she didn’t know when to start. And with the man’s statement simply added another questions on her list. Why did he say that ? He’s seen me before ?

“Daddy,” ByulHee said, “Who are these people ?” She whispered the last part though but somehow could still be heard by the couple in front of her. ByulHee didn’t notice it but the couple’s faces fell a little as she didn’t recognize who they were.

With a sigh, Chen took her hand and locked eyes for a moment with the two people in front of him. This has to be done, Chen thought as he tried to send the message with only his eyes. She’s old enough to know the truth. But I need to tell her privately.  As if on cue, the couple stood up and left the living room before walking to the kitchen.
